I find everyone is up for chocolate. I have tried making the middle layer with different flavors of instant pudding, but chocolate always the favorite, and what better way to go than death by chocolate!

Blue Ribbon Recipe

Whoa... this is a chocolate lover's dream dessert recipe! The base is a tender, gooey brownie full of extra chocolate. The center layer has a creamy, almost mousse-like, texture. Then, they're topped with a fudgy chocolate ganache that sends these over the top. Have a glass of milk handy to wash 'em down. They're rich and fantastic!

Ingredients For death by chocolate 3 layer brownies

  • 1 box
    dark chocolate brownie mix 18 to 20 oz
  • 1 c
    semi-sweet mini chocloate chips
  • MIDDLE LAYER
  • 12 Tbsp
    unsalted butter, room temperature (1 & 1/2 cubes)
  • 3 c
    powdered sugar
  • 1/2 c
    heavy whipping cream
  • 3 Tbsp
    dark chocolate instant pudding mix
  • 2 Tbsp
    cocoa powder
  • 1 tsp
    pure vanilla extract
  • GANACHE TOP LAYER
  • 1 c
    heavy whipping cream
  • 12 oz
    bag of chocolate chips (2 cups)
  • 2 tsp
    pure vanilla extract

How To Make death by chocolate 3 layer brownies

  • Oven preheating.
    1
    Preheat oven to 350. Butter 9"x13" pan, I use a 10"x10" pan if you have one it works great.
  • Folding chocolate chips into prepared brownie mix.
    2
    Mix brownie according to package directions. Then fold in mini chocolate chips.
  • Brownies baking in the oven.
    3
    Bake according to package directions. Once baked cool completely.
  • Butter, powdered sugar, heavy cream, pudding mix, and cocoa powder whipped together.
    4
    Middle Layer: In mixing bowl combine butter, powdered sugar, heavy cream, pudding mix, and cocoa powder. Beat with whip beater till light and creamy.
  • Chocolate mixture spread over brownies.
    5
    Spread evenly on the cooled brownie and place in fridge while you make the top layer.
  • Chocolate chips in a glass bowl.
    6
    Top Ganache Layer: Place chocolate chips in a glass bowl and set aside.
  • Pouring hot cream over chocolate chips.
    7
    In a small saucepan bring heavy cream to a boil. Pour cream over the chocolate chips.
  • Chocolate chips and hot cream sitting in a bowl.
    8
    Cover the bowl and let sit for 10 minutes.
  • Whisking ingredients together.
    9
    Then using a wire whisk, whip together the chocolate and cream till smooth and creamy, it will have a satiny looking finish. Whisk in vanilla extract.
  • Ganache poured over brownies.
    10
    Then pour over the top of the brownie spread to smooth. Return the brownies to the fridge and chill at least 2 hours before cutting and serving.
  • Death By Chocolate 3 Layer Brownies cut into squares.
    11
    Cut brownies into 1 1/2" x 1 1/2" square pieces and serve. They are quite rich so smaller pieces are better. Store in an airtight container in the fridge. Remove from the fridge at least a half-hour before serving. Break out the coffee and enjoy them together!
